From af57b0f1cb83d12caa313b5ec0eb51f9aa7161b1 Mon Sep 17 00:00:00 2001 From: zhujie81 Date: Fri, 10 Jun 2022 20:16:15 +0800 Subject: [PATCH] add setinterrupt interface of docs Signed-off-by: zhujie81 --- .../reference/apis/js-apis-audio.md | 20 +++++++++++++++++++ 1 file changed, 20 insertions(+) diff --git a/zh-cn/application-dev/reference/apis/js-apis-audio.md b/zh-cn/application-dev/reference/apis/js-apis-audio.md index 2b946065da..b8a142e3ba 100644 --- a/zh-cn/application-dev/reference/apis/js-apis-audio.md +++ b/zh-cn/application-dev/reference/apis/js-apis-audio.md @@ -2514,7 +2514,27 @@ setInterruptMode(interruptMode: InterruptMode): Promise<void> audioManager.setInterruptMode(audio.InterruptType.SHARE_MODE).then(() => { console.log('Promise returned to indicate a successful volume setting.'); }); +``` +### setInterruptMode9+ + +setInterruptMode(interruptMode: InterruptMode): Promise<void> + +设置应用的焦点模型。使用Promise异步回调。 + +**系统能力:** SystemCapability.Multimedia.Audio.Renderer + +**参数:** +| 参数名 | 类型 | 必填 | 说明 | +| ---------- | ----------------------------------- | ---- | -------------------------------------------------------- | +| interruptMode | [InterruptMode](#InterruptMode) | 是 | 焦点模型。 | +callback | Callback<[void](#)> | 是 |回调返回执行结果,设置成功时返回undefined,否则返回error。 + + + +**示例:** + +``` audioManager.setInterruptMode(audio.InterruptType.SHARE_MODE,()=>{ console.log('Promise returned to indicate a successful volume setting.'); }); -- GitLab